Outlander Prequel: First Look & Premiere Date REVEALED!

The upcoming show “Blood of My Blood” is actually a prequel to “Outlander,” which first aired on Starz back in 2014 and has since completed seven seasons, with another one about to start. Unlike the original series, “Blood of My Blood” will introduce new characters and actors, but it will also delve into the pasts of characters we already know from the original show, offering fresh perspectives on some of the events that took place in the original series as well.

Destiny 2 Expansion Hype: What to Expect from Bungie’s Upcoming Reveal!

The buzz about Destiny 2’s upcoming expansions, Apollo and Behemoth, has ignited passionate conversations among gamers. A community member named ThunderBeanage hinted that the “coming year” may offer more than just a glimpse of the next expansion, sparking speculation about a larger storyline connecting both expansions. Although players are eager for detailed previews of Apollo, many expect minimal information on Behemoth, recognizing that Bungie typically reveals information gradually to keep fans engaged. As one user commented, “They always say ‘and more,'” implying that gamers might need to manage their expectations.
